标题:快速TF签名:苹果签名技术深度解析与实战经验分享

发布时间:2026-05-27 04:01 | ID: 1609

作为一名长期接触苹果签名技术的爱好者,我对这一领域有着深刻的理解和丰富的实践经验。本文将从签名技术原理、证书池机制、UDID绑定、重签流程、超级签名与企业签名的稳定性对比等多个方面,详细解析苹果签名技术,并结合实际操作,分享我的使用心得。

一、签名技术原理

苹果签名技术是一种授权技术,它允许开发者将自己的应用安装到iOS设备上,即使这些应用未在App Store上发布。其原理是通过苹果提供的证书和私钥,对应用进行签名,使其在设备上运行。

二、证书池机制

苹果签名证书分为开发证书和发布证书。开发证书用于开发测试阶段,而发布证书用于正式发布的应用。证书池机制是指苹果为开发者提供一定数量的证书,开发者可以在池中申请和使用这些证书。

三、UDID绑定

UDID是iOS设备的唯一标识符,通过UDID绑定,开发者可以将应用与特定设备绑定,实现设备专属安装。然而,苹果已宣布停止提供UDID,因此UDID绑定在当前环境中已不再适用。

四、重签流程

重签流程是指将已签名的应用重新签名,使其在设备上继续运行。重签流程包括以下步骤:

1. 生成新的证书和私钥;
2. 使用新的证书和私钥对应用进行签名;
3. 将签名后的应用安装到设备上。

五、超级签名与企业签名的稳定性对比

超级签名是指通过破解苹果服务器,获取证书和私钥,对应用进行签名。企业签名是指使用苹果官方提供的证书和私钥对应用进行签名。两者在稳定性方面存在一定差异:

1. 超级签名:稳定性较差,容易掉签,需要不断寻找新的证书和私钥;
2. 企业签名:稳定性较高,但成本较高,且需要企业资质。

六、不同渠道价格

1. 超级签名:价格较低,一般在几十元到几百元不等;
2. 企业签名:价格较高,一般在几千元到上万元不等。

七、好用稳定的签名方法

1. IPA签名:将应用打包成IPA格式,然后使用证书和私钥进行签名。IPA签名稳定性较高,但需要具备一定的技术能力。

2. H5封装:将应用封装成H5页面,然后通过网页访问实现应用功能。H5封装操作简单,但稳定性较差。

3. 官方上架:将应用提交到App Store进行审核,通过后即可在App Store上下载。官方上架稳定性高,但审核周期较长。

4. TF签名:使用第三方平台提供的证书和私钥对应用进行签名。TF签名操作简单,稳定性较高,但需要支付一定费用。

八、掉签、补签、证书问题

在实际操作过程中,可能会遇到掉签、补签、证书问题。以下是一些应对方法:

1. 掉签:重新获取证书和私钥,对应用进行签名;
2. 补签:将掉签后的应用重新签名,安装到设备上;
3. 证书问题:检查证书是否过期,或重新申请证书。

总结

苹果签名技术在我国拥有广泛的应用,掌握这一技术对于开发者来说至关重要。本文从多个方面解析了苹果签名技术,并结合实际操作,分享了使用心得。希望对广大开发者有所帮助。

← 返回首页